How to measure the quality of three-phase asynchronous motor

The quality of the three-phase asynchronous motor can be measured by the following methods:

Check with a multimeter. A multimeter can be used to detect the resistance between the three windings of the motor, and its value should be basically equal and not zero. At the same time, check the insulation resistance between each winding and the shell, which is required to be above 0.5MΩ.

Measure with insulation resistance meter. The insulation resistance of the motor to the ground and the insulation resistance between the two phases of the motor are measured respectively, and the insulation resistance value should not be less than 1 megohm at 120 RPM.

No-load running test. The no-load running test can accurately measure the resistance of the motor winding through the single-arm bridge. If the resistance value deviation is large, the motor may be faulty.

Short circuit test. The motor is short-circuit tested under the rated voltage, the short-circuit current of the motor is observed, and the coil of the motor is judged whether there is an inter-turn short circuit according to the current value.

Auscultation test. Close the ear to the motor, carefully listen to its sound, if you hear a noise, it indicates that the motor is faulty.

The current test. Test the working current of the motor with a clamp ammeter to observe whether the current exceeds the rated current, if it exceeds the rated current, it indicates that the motor is faulty.

The above methods are common methods for detecting the quality of three-phase asynchronous motors, and the appropriate method is selected for measurement according to the specific situation.
